Iheanacho On Maiden Goal For Leicester : Expect More Goals From Me
Published: October 25, 2017
Kelechi Iheanacho was pleased to score his first goal in a Leicester City shirt in their 3-1 win over Leeds United in the fourth round of the League Cup on Tuesday, and has insisted that there is plenty more to come.
Since joining the Foxes, the Nigeria international has played 281 minutes in seven matches across all competitions, and his goal and assist against Leeds United was the first time he has contributed to goals, having struggled with his fitness at the start of the season.
''I wanted to take it with my right foot but I wasn’t too sure, so I got it back onto my left foot and put it into the corner,'' Iheanacho told LCFC TV.
''It was a great goal so I’m happy to get a goal and help the team to go to the next round.
''It means a lot to me. I’m happy to get my first goal and I hope there are many more to come in the future.''
Kelechi Iheanacho made Leicester City's starting line-up for the third time this season on Tuesday.
